CEA-targeted CAR-T cells is an investigational cell therapy being studied for CEA-positive advanced solid tumors, including lung cancer, colorectal cancer, and gastric cancer. It is in Phase 1 clinical development for these indications.
CEA-targeted CAR-T cells targets carcinoembryonic antigen (CEA), a protein expressed on the surface of certain tumor cells. The therapy is designed to recognize and attack CEA-positive cancer cells in patients with advanced solid tumors.
CEA-targeted CAR-T cells is being developed by Precision BioSciences, Inc., a biopharmaceutical company traded on NASDAQ under the ticker DTIL. The therapy is currently in Phase 1 clinical trials.
CEA-targeted CAR-T cells is in Phase 1 clinical development. It is an investigational therapy and has not been approved by regulatory authorities. Multiple Phase 1 trials are currently recruiting patients with CEA-positive advanced solid tumors.
CEA-targeted CAR-T cells is being studied in several Phase 1 trials, including NCT06006390, NCT06043466, NCT06126406, and NCT07179692. These trials are recruiting patients with various CEA-positive advanced solid tumors, such as gastric, colorectal, and lung cancers.
CEA-targeted CAR-T cells is a specific chimeric antigen receptor T-cell therapy that targets CEA. It is distinct from CAR-T therapies targeting other antigens, such as CD19 or BCMA, which are used for different cancer types.
